Karolína Plíšková: A Force in Women’s Tennis

Introduction
Karolína Plíšková, a prominent figure in women’s tennis, has made significant strides on the international scene. Born on March 21, 1992, in the Czech Republic, her career has been marked by remarkable achievements, including a top ranking of World No. 1 in July 2017.
